Despite this maxim, one of the most asked questions I receive is this: how does one craft a good article?

It seems that even if most internet businessmen know that they have to pursue article marketing, not everyone is capable enough to come up with a made-for-the-internet type of informative work.

Hence, I have written down some easy to follow steps on how you can create the best kind of good article for internet advertising purposes.

  1. Know the subject you want to discuss with your article.
  2. Don’t try to tackle a broad topic.  Break it down to a more specific subject that people will be fascinated with.  Just to illustrate, don’t tackle the general topic of “dogs.”  Try to determine a sub-topic that will win the imagination of the people you will be aiming for.  Usually, this sub-topic points to a particular need, like “dog training” for dog owners who are having problems with their unruly pets, or “dog grooming” for clealiness compulsive dog owners who can’t survive the smell of their dirty canine companions.  You need to discover a sub-topic that will make people take notice.  This is very important.  A lot of articles fail because they don’t discuss a more particular subject.
  3. Because the sub-topic should serve a need, your article must be able to share a solution.  However, depending on how the article will be used, the answer you will discuss will vary.  To illustrate, if the purpose of the article is to promote a product, then hold back on the remedy you will provide.  Your aim, in such a case, is to give the impression that you are an expert in the field, and compel your readers to study what you will be offering.  Keep this in mind throughout the writing process.
  4. Create a catchy grabbing title that is immediately understandable but nevertheless exciting.  People will check out your article if they will like its title.  Otherwise, no one will get to read what you have prepared.
  5. Always remind yourself that every article has 3 essential components: the opening, the body, and the conclusion.  The introduction will state to your audience what your piece is all about.  You can inform them of a surprising fact, a revealing statistic, or a funny analogy to jerk your readers into realizing that yes, you are the a true expert in the field.  The body will discuss the information you desire to relay, naturally.  And the conclusion will review the problem, the provided solution, as well as interject some calls to action (i.e. click my link) if applicable.
  6. What is the right length for articles of this nature? I’d say that 300 to 750 words would be fantastic!
